Freedom of religion in Canada is under threat.

December 16, 2025

In Justice Committee, instead of reversing their failed bail reforms, the current government is focusing on Bill C-9, which will expose people of faith to criminal prosecution for the simple act of quoting their own sacred texts.

The former Chair of the committee, Marc Miller, said there were “clearly hateful” statements in some books of the Bible and Torah. Removing the religious freedom safeguard from the Criminal Code will not make Canadians safer.

This is leading us down a dangerous path.

Larry Brock joins me on the Blueprint: Canada’s Conservative Podcast to discuss what’s been happening at Justice Committee and much more.

Reintroduce mandatory minimum sentences

November 12, 2025

The details in a recent case before the Supreme Court are appalling.

Two men were found with possession of literally hundreds of images and videos of children as young as three years old.

Instead of sending them away for a very long time, the Court used imaginary scenarios rather than the facts before them to issue this disgusting ruling.

Despite this, the the current government is more concerned with the Charter rights of child sexual abusers than the Charter rights of innocent children.

Conservatives would use the notwithstanding clause to reintroduce mandatory minimum sentences for possession of child sexual abuse material and ensure people like these before the court are in prison where they belong.

Larry Brock joins me, once again, on the Blueprint: Canada’s Conservative Podcast to dive deeper into this heart-wrenching issue and much more.

Uncovering ArriveCan (Yet Again)

March 19, 2024

Uncovering corruption is never an easy task, and the current Government certainly doesn’t make it any easier. The ArriveCan saga has reached a point to where Canadians not only know that $60 million of their money was spent on an app that nobody wanted and didn’t work, but they now know after numerous testimonies that GC Strategies is “proud” of the app they created. The same app that wrongfully put people into unnecessary quarantine and divided Canadians from one another. Watch and listen as my guest, Larry Brock, and I provide updates on the testimonies happening in committee, how the government granted the 2-person IT firm $20 million through a cozy contract, and much more.
